Casement windows are a great way to cut down on energy usage

Casement windows are a great way to save energy by letting sunlight into your home. They also offer a stunning elegant alternative to double-hung windows. In addition to being energy efficient, casement windows are simple to operate.

In many cases, casement windows come with low-emissivity or low-E glass. This coating reduces heat, UV light, and prevents condensation.

Sash windows benefit from modern restoration

Sash windows are a recognizable feature of period properties. They are stunning to see, and provide character to homes. They are vulnerable to damage. Common problems include broken glass, draughts and frames that are rotting. If you have a sash window at your home, you may think about a renovation. This is not only cheaper than replacing the entire window, but it can also preserve the aesthetic appeal of your home.

It is best to consult an expert in window and joinery when you need to repair sash replacement windows. These craftsmen can restore them to their previous glory.

Older sash windows are vulnerable to many common problems. The glazing bars could crack and become rotted, the cables may decay and the weights could be misaligned. These are all typical issues, but they can be solved with a little effort.
